Страница 1 из 2

Обратная связь

Добавлено: Ср авг 26, 2009 16:20:54
izmmisha
Добрый день, я начинающий, поэтому сильно не бить ;)

Значит имеется МК, он подает сигнал, открывает транзистор, в цепи катушки, катушка при изменении тока сопротивляется потихоньку, ток в цепи начинает нарастать. Хотелось бы получить обратную связь в МК о достижении тока в цепи катушки определенного значения.

Подскажите как сделать обратную связь в МК?

Возможен ли такой вариант: в цепи катушки разместить резистор, падение напряжения на котором открывало бы транзистор и на МК подавалась бы 1 (схема во вложении).

Добавлено: Ср авг 26, 2009 16:35:37
ibiza11
проще сразу с резистора на вход ацп или хотя бы аналогового компаратора.

Добавлено: Ср авг 26, 2009 16:38:25
izmmisha
Вариант, но я хочу повесить прерывание на этот порт, т.е. он будет цифровой.
И не хотелось чтобы ток через МК протекал, в цепи катушки ток до 2А может возрастать и более

Добавлено: Ср авг 26, 2009 18:24:56
Барсик
Можно сделать, как в прикошаченном файле. Резистор R1 рассчитать так, чтобы при нужном токе на нём падало 0,6 вольта. Транзистор откроется, и на вход МК будет подан лог. 0. На входе МК надо включить подтягивающий резистор.

Добавлено: Ср авг 26, 2009 19:02:35
izmmisha
Внес ваше предложение в схему:
Получается если транзистор V2 закрыт, то закрыт транзистор V3, и через резистор R4 на МК подается 1. Когда же открывается транзистор V2 и ток в цепи достигает нужного уровня (R2>>R1, ток на R2 не значителен), открывается транзистор V3 и ток идущий по R4 делится на R3 и на МК (R3 > R4), и на МК подается 0.

Добавлено: Ср авг 26, 2009 20:05:37
GP1
не мешало бы диодик параллельно катушке поставить, а то ваша схема только один раз отключится. :roll:

Добавлено: Ср авг 26, 2009 20:08:59
izmmisha
Транзистор V2(BU941ZP) выдерживает напряжение 350 вольт, не хватит?

Добавлено: Ср авг 26, 2009 20:11:44
GP1
дык напруга будет расти до тех пор пока не произойдет разряд, либо межвитковый пробой, либо соотвтственно транзюк, выбирайте сами :)))

Добавлено: Ср авг 26, 2009 20:21:38
izmmisha
Напряжение не будет расти, оно мгновенно меняется и потом падает. Надо бы прикинуть сопротивление транзистора и рассчитать максимальное напряжение в момент отключения.

Катушка в этой схеме - это первичная обмотка катушки зажигания от мотоцикла урал. В штатной схеме зажигания при размыкании прерывателя катушка коммутируется на конденсатор.

Добавлено: Ср авг 26, 2009 20:29:55
GP1
ну так и надо писать: "энергия катушки гасится при пробоее искрового зазора свечи зажигания.." (ну типа такого) и все было бы ясно. :wink:

ЗЫ но я бы всетаки обратную связь завел на компаратор ИМХО.

Добавлено: Ср авг 26, 2009 20:33:31
izmmisha
Прошу прощения, я же говорю, что я плохо разбираюсь, а последнее ваше замечание очень правильное, сейчас я хоть буду знать как это сформулировать ;)

Спасибо всем, осталось рассчитать параметры элементов...

Добавлено: Ср авг 26, 2009 20:43:26
izmmisha
GP1 писал(а):ЗЫ но я бы всетаки обратную связь завел на компаратор ИМХО.
Глянул датащит на ATtiny261, там прерывание есть.
Правильно ли я понял как происходит сравнение:
на один пин подается эталонное напряжение
на другой пин подается тестируемое напряжение
ну и когда тестируемое напряжение допустим меняет состояние из не превышающего эталон на превышающее вызывается прерывание?

Добавлено: Ср авг 26, 2009 20:47:03
GP1
точно так, и вот как раз в прерывании и можно выключить (если надо) выход

вот только меня смущает тот факт что разрыв цепи питания катушки должен совпадать с моментом искрообразования, т.е. ориентировани относительно ВМТ а не тока катушки?

Добавлено: Ср авг 26, 2009 20:51:10
izmmisha
А как рассчитать сопротивление резистора чтобы задать эталон 0.6В к примеру? или там не просто резистором задается, а еще как сложнее, подскажите.

Добавлено: Ср авг 26, 2009 20:56:12
izmmisha
GP1 писал(а):вот только меня смущает тот факт что разрыв цепи питания катушки должен совпадать с моментом искрообразования, т.е. ориентировани относительно ВМТ а не тока катушки?
Я хочу сделать зажигание батарейного типа (TDI), где энергия накапливается в катушке. Опережение зажигания будет рассчитываться от момента срабатывания датчика (40 градусов до ВМТ), учитываться будут обороты двигателя и нагрузка двигателя (датчик положения дроссельной заслонки). Ну а т.к. катушка будет носителем заряда ей нужно время на его накопление, поэтому это время тоже надо учитывать и такая схема с использованием обратной связью дает возможность использовать различные катушки зажигания, рассчитывая необходимое сопротивление R1.

Добавлено: Ср авг 26, 2009 20:56:30
GP1
Закон Ома рулит!
U=IR
U=0,6В, ток я думаю вам тоже известен, ну а резюк вычислите путем взятия интеграла по объему микропроцессора (шучу)
Но, у вас получится довольно большое значение, что в данном случае очень не есть гуд, на высоких оборотах КЗ не будет набирать необходимой энергии и как следствие будет падать энергия искры, а это сами понимаете...

Добавлено: Ср авг 26, 2009 21:01:08
izmmisha
GP1 писал(а):Закон Ома рулит!
U=IR
U=0,6В, ток я думаю вам тоже известен, ну а резюк вычислите путем взятия интеграла по объему микропроцессора (шучу)
Меня интересует как подать эталонное напряжение на МК, и в этой цепи мне сила тока не известна ;)

Добавлено: Ср авг 26, 2009 21:08:35
GP1
на одном входе у нас понятно что, на дугом напруга с резистивного делителя (тот же самый закон Ома), можно поставить подстроечник для большей лучшести.

Добавлено: Ср авг 26, 2009 21:22:30
izmmisha
Чет сразу не догадался, подобно тому как и тестируемое же...
Вот схема при использовании компаратора.
Uэт=IR3, I=5/(R3+R4), сила тока нужна минимальная 0.1 мА
R3 = 0.6/10^-7 = 6МОм
R4 = 44МОм
такие бывают? ;)
Ну можно и побольше ток сделать...

Добавлено: Ср авг 26, 2009 21:46:20
GP1
если не бывает - собрать из нескольких параллельно-последовательно соединенных.
схема в первом приближении попрет :wink: